What is Zinc sulfide used for?Dec 22,2022 Zinc sulfide is an inorganic compound, the chemical formula is ZnS, the appearance is white or slightly yellow powder, and the color will become darker when exposed to light. It is stable in dry air, and it will gradually oxidize to zinc sulfate...
What is photosynthesis? Photosynthesis is the process used by plants, algae and somebacteriato turn sunlight into energy. The process chemically converts carbon dioxide (CO2) and water into food (sugars) andoxygen. The chemical reaction often relies on a pigment called chlorophyll, which gives ...
